Product Introduction
SitaCIP E 25mg/100mg Tablet is a medicine used to treat Type 2 diabetes mellitus. It lowers blood sugar by helping the kidneys remove excess glucose and by improving the body’s insulin response for better glucose control. When combined with a healthy lifestyle, it supports effective long-term diabetes management.
Take SitaCIP E 25mg/100mg Tablet regularly as prescribed to keep your blood sugar levels under control. Consistent use helps the medicine work effectively and reduces the risk of serious diabetes-related complications such as nerve damage, kidney problems, and heart issues. Even if you start feeling better, do not stop taking it without your doctor’s advice, as diabetes is a long-term condition that requires ongoing care. Follow your treatment plan, along with healthy eating and regular exercise, for better long-term outcomes.
SitaCIP E 25mg/100mg Tablet may cause some common side effects such as urinary tract infections, upper respiratory tract infections, fungal infections, and headaches. If any of these side effects persist or worsen, discuss them with your doctor. They may recommend supportive treatment or adjust your dosage.
Before using SitaCIP E 25mg/100mg Tablet, tell your doctor if you have any history of kidney or liver problems, urinary tract infections, or heart conditions. This medicine is not recommended for people with type 1 diabetes or a history of diabetic ketoacidosis. It should be used with caution in older adults and in those who are dehydrated or on diuretics, as it may increase the risk of low blood pressure. Pregnant and breastfeeding women should consult their doctor before taking this medicine to ensure safety.

How to Use SitaCIP E Tablet
Take this medicine in the dose and duration advised by your doctor. Swallow it whole with water. Do not chew, crush, or break the tablet. It may be taken with or without food, but it is better to take it at a fixed time each day.
How SitaCIP E Tablet Works
SitaCIP E 25mg/100mg Tablet contains two active ingredients — Empagliflozin and Sitagliptin — which help control blood sugar levels in people with type 2 diabetes.
-
Empagliflozin (SGLT2 inhibitor) helps the kidneys remove excess glucose through urine.
-
Sitagliptin (DPP-4 inhibitor) increases insulin release and reduces glucose production in the liver.
Together, they provide improved blood sugar control compared with either medicine alone.
Safety Advice
Alcohol: Consult your doctor before consuming alcohol while taking this medicine.
Pregnancy: Use with caution; consult your doctor before use.
Breastfeeding: Not recommended, as it may pass into breast milk.
Driving: Be cautious if blood sugar levels are too low or too high.
Kidney: Use with caution in patients with kidney disease. Dose adjustment may be needed.
Liver: Limited data; consult your doctor before use.
What If You Forget to Take SitaCIP E Tablet?
If you miss a dose, take it as soon as you remember. If it is almost time for your next dose, skip the missed dose and continue with your regular schedule. Do not double the dose to make up for a missed one.
